Note 9 – STOCKHOLDERS’ EQUITY

 

The Company is authorized to issue an aggregate of 4,000,000,000 shares of common stock with a par value of $0.0001. The Company is also authorized to issue 10,000,000 shares of “blank check” preferred stock with a par value of $0.0001, which includes 4,000,000 shares of Series A preferred stock (“Series A”), 66,667 shares of Series B preferred stock (“Series B”), and 2,000,000 shares of Series C preferred stock (“Series C”) ...

 

Under the Certificate of Designation, holders of Series A Preferred Stock will participate on an equal basis per-share with holders of our common stock in any distribution upon winding up, dissolution, or liquidation. Holders of Series A Preferred Stock are entitled to vote together with the holders of our common stock on all matters submitted to shareholders at a rate of three hundred (300) votes for each share held.

 

On January 5, 2016, pursuant to Article III of our Articles of Incorporation, the Company’s Board of Directors voted to designate a class of preferred stock entitled Series B Convertible Preferred Stock, consisting of up 66,667 shares, par value $0.0001. Under the Certificate of Designation, holders of Series B Convertible Preferred Stock participate on an equal basis per-share with holders of the Company’s common stock and Series A Preferred Stock in any distribution upon winding up, dissolution, or liquidation. Holders of Series B Convertible Preferred Stock are not entitled to voting rights.

 

On May 9, 2017, the Board of Directors voted to designate a class of preferred stock entitled Series C Convertible Preferred Stock, consisting of up to 2,000,000 shares, par value $0.0001. Under the Certificate of Designation, holders of Series C Convertible Preferred Stock will participate on an equal basis per-share with holders of common stock, Series A Preferred Stock and Series B Preferred Stock in any distribution upon winding up, dissolution, or liquidation. Holders of Series C Convertible Preferred Stock are entitled to vote together with the holders of our common stock on all matters submitted to shareholders at a rate of 875 votes for each share held. Holders of Series C Convertible Preferred Stock are entitled to convert each share held for 875 shares of common stock.

 

On February 16, 2017, the Company issued a total of 2,000,000 shares of our common stock (post-split) to our officer and director, Wais Asefi, as compensation for services rendered. During the year ended December 31, 2017, the officer exchanged the common shares for 2,000,000 shares of newly designated Series C Preferred stock.

 

During the year ended December 31, 2017, the Company issued 1,608,877 shares of common stock (post-split) for the partial conversion and settlements of $765,217. The converted portion of the notes also had associated derivative liabilities with fair values on the date of conversion of $1,271,691. The conversion of the derivative liabilities has been recorded through additional paid-in capital.

 

During the year ended December 31, 2017, the Company issued 299,397 shares of common stock (post-split) valued at $109,571 for the settlement of debt related to a 3a10 settlement.

 

During the year ended December 31, 2017, the Company issued 77,500 shares of common stock (post-split) for services valued at $115,100.

 

During the year ended December 31, 2016, the Company issued 141,260 (post split) shares of common stock with a fair value of $635,299 for the conversion of convertible notes payable. The converted portion of the notes also had associated derivative liabilities with fair values on the date of conversion of $1,573,238. The conversion of the derivative liabilities has been recorded through additional paid-in capital.

 

During the year ended December 31, 2016, the Company issued 8,000 (post split) shares of common stock valued at $478,700 for services.

 

During the year ended December 31, 2016, the Company’s CEO returned and the Company retired 59,400 (post split) shares of common stock.
